About The Flowr Corporation

Engaged in the cultivation, processing, and distribution of cannabis, The Flowr Corporation primarily operates within Canada. The company offers a range of products, including dried flower and pre-rolled cannabis. Beyond its Canadian base, the firm also conducts operations in Portugal and across the European Union. Founded in 2016, its corporate headquarters are located in Toronto, Canada.
